The Aviation Industry Union IAU has announced industrial action that will cause widespread disruption to critical operations at Helsinki-Vantaa Airport on Tuesday 17 and Thursday 19 June.

The four-hour industrial action will target different work shifts. Finnair estimates that the impact of the industrial action will be more significant than previous strikes.

Finnair says it will start canceling flights on strike days two days before the flight’s departure date.
